package harness
import (
"context"
"fmt"
"time"
"github.com/fatih/color"
)
// Harness is a support structure that runs tasks, the harness can be customized with
// pre- and post- execution hook functions, where common functionality to all tasks
// can be defined.
type Harness struct {
PreExecHook Task
PostExecHook Task
}
// New constructs a harness.
func New(opts ...Option) *Harness {
h := Harness{
PreExecHook: func(_ context.Context) error { return nil },
PostExecHook: func(_ context.Context) error { return nil },
}
for _, opt := range opts {
opt(&h)
}
return &h
}
// Execute a list of tasks inside the harness.
// Every task inside the harness is run sequentially, showing a consistent output where
// the task status and timing info are clearly visible.
func (h *Harness) Execute(ctx context.Context, tasks ...Task) error {
var errs []string
start := time.Now()
if err := h.PreExecHook(ctx); err != nil {
return fmt.Errorf("failed to initialize ci harness: %s", err.Error())
}
for i := range tasks {
task := tasks[i]
if err := task(ctx); err != nil {
errs = append(errs, err.Error())
}
}
if err := h.PostExecHook(ctx); err != nil {
return fmt.Errorf("failed to run post exec hook: %s", err.Error())
}
elapsed := time.Since(start).Round(time.Millisecond)
fmt.Printf("\n------------------------\n\n")
if len(errs) > 0 {
color.Red(" ✘ finished with errors after %s", elapsed)
for _, errmsg := range errs {
color.Red(" • %s", errmsg)
}
fmt.Printf("\n")
return fmt.Errorf("task finished with errors")
}
color.Green("✔ all good after %s\n\n", elapsed)
return nil
}
// Task defines the basic function that the harness executes.
// Additional configuration and tweaks can be done by using clojures which return
// Tasks.
type Task func(ctx context.Context) error
type Option func(h *Harness)
// WithPreExecFunc allows specifying a task that will be run every execution, before the
// specific execution tasks are run.
func WithPreExecFunc(hook Task) Option {
return func(h *Harness) {
h.PreExecHook = hook
}
}
